The New Standard in Linear Lighting
DMF Lighting’s Artafex Linear series is designed to provide integrators with a simple, yet robust solution that meets the ever-growing demand for linear lighting in residential applications. Unlike the traditional alternative, which often requires complex installation and time-consuming soldering, Artafex Linear offers a streamlined, easy-to-install system with magnetic connectors, removing the need for field cutting and reducing installation time. This modular system allows for the flexibility to make adjustments on-site without compromising performance.
DMF Lighting’s Artafex Linear key features include:
Modular Design: Available in one-foot, two-inch, and one-inch increments, allowing for easy customization and installation. The magnetic connectors snap seamlessly into place, ensuring reliable connections and a smooth, continuous lighting effect without gaps.
Premium Build: The fixture is designed with a premium soft-touch silicone lens that prevents dust buildup, making it ideal for residential environments. The lens, combined with a dense array of highly efficient LEDs, provides high efficacy with dot-free performance, eliminating the compromises found in other products.
Superior Warm Dim Matching: Artafex Linear features a Warm Dim option that matches DMF Lighting’s popular Warm Dim downlight color temperature curve, ensuring consistent lighting across various fixtures in a home. It can also be set at 2000K, 2700K and 3000K for those preferring a static color temperature.
Simplified Ordering Process: The Artafex Linear product line was designed with the integrator in mind, providing an ordering process that is both flexible and user-friendly. Whether an integrator is a beginner in lighting or an experienced professional, the ordering system adapts to their level of knowledge and project requirements. The three ways to order include:
- Order by Total Footage: Ideal for projects where quick estimates are needed, integrators can simply input the total linear footage required for the project and choose the preferred mounting type—flat or 45-degree. The system automatically generates a complete bill of materials (BOM), including the appropriate number of fixtures, connectors, drivers, and other essential components.
- Order by Zone: For more complex projects where multiple control zones are required, integrators can specify the length and mounting type for each zone, such as kitchen under-cabinet lighting or living room cove lighting. The system creates a separate BOM for each zone, helping to label and organize components by specific areas within the project, ensuring that the right materials are deployed to the right locations.
- Order by Individual Components: For integrators who prefer to build their own configurations or need specific parts, this option allows them to manually select the exact components required for their projects. This method is ideal for advanced users who want precise control over their inventory.
Artafex Linear Kit for Faster Installations: One of the standout features of the Artafex Linear product line is the Artafex Linear Kit, which simplifies installation and reduces job site complications. Each kit comes packed in a specially designed tray box and includes:
- 10 x 12-inch linear fixtures
- 4 x 2-inch linear sections
- 1 x 1-inch linear section
- A selection of joiners, dead ends, power feeds, and jumpers
By including a variety of linear lengths and connection accessories, the kit covers a wide range of installation scenarios, allowing integrators to adapt quickly to changes in the field. The kit’s modular nature ensures faster, easier installations without compromising on performance or aesthetics.

A Game-Changer for Integrators
Integrators have long faced challenges with LED tape, from confusing specification processes to unreliable connectors and field soldering that requires extensive training. Artafex Linear eliminates these issues by offering a plug-and-play solution that is as easy to install as it is to maintain. Additionally, DMF Lighting’s open architecture design allows integrators to seamlessly integrate Artafex Linear with the control systems they’re already familiar with, providing flexibility and compatibility with most popular platforms.
